Ajjampur is a small city in Karnataka, India with a population of 10,795. Elevation: 2,480 ft (756 m). Average temperature: 76°F (25°C).

Ajjampur has a seasonal temperature swing of 12°F — from 72°F in December to 83°F in April. Total annual precipitation is 21.1 inches, with October being the wettest month (5.1") and January the driest (0.0").
